What the Apple Sports Integration Means
Apple Sports version 3.7 now supports PGA and LPGA tournaments with live leaderboards, round-by-round scorecards, and real-time updates. Users get live activities on lock screens, widgets for home screens, and instant tournament data access.
Golf has officially entered the consumer tech mainstream alongside Formula 1, the NBA, and major football leagues. That changes a lot for facility operators.
